There was no winner between Aucas and Mushuc Runa, in date 1 of the Ecuabet League

Aucas and Mushuc Runa ended in a 1-1 draw during the first match of the Ecuabet League.

In the opening match of the Ecuabet League, Aucas and Mushuc Runa played to a tense 1-1 draw at the Gonzalo Pozo Ripalda Stadium in Quito on Saturday. Aucas initially took the lead in first-half stoppage time, thanks to a penalty converted by Bruno Miranda. However, the game shifted in the second half as Mushuc Runa improved their performance significantly.

Following a more aggressive approach after the halftime break, Mushuc Runa equalized in the 59th minute with a goal from Manuel Gamboa, putting pressure on Aucas and demonstrating their competitive spirit. The match saw Aucas finish with two players sent off, Stiven Tapiero and Virgilio Olaya, which further complicated their efforts to regain control of the game.

This match marks the beginning of the Ecuabet League season, with both teams showing glimpses of potential despite the draw. The dynamic of the match raises questions about Aucas's discipline and depth, particularly with their early-season expulsion issues, while Mushuc Runa's resilience may set a positive tone for their campaign ahead.
